AGC Joins Malaysia’s Landmark Nearly-ZEB Retrofit Pilot, Betting on Glass to Cut Building Energy Use by Three-Quarters

Tokyo-based glass major brings Low-E and photovoltaic glazing to Southeast Asia’s first net-zero retrofit of an existing office tower

Japanese materials giant AGC Inc. has signed on as a technology partner in what’s being billed as Malaysia’s inaugural Nearly Zero Energy Building (Nearly ZEB) retrofit – a pilot scheme targeting a 75% cut in primary energy use at an aging office block, using little more than smarter glass and rooftop-to-facade solar integration.

The building in question belongs to Malaysia’s Sustainable Energy Development Authority (SEDA) itself – a fitting test case, given the agency’s own mandate. At 21 years old, the headquarters was never designed with net-zero ambitions in mind, which is exactly why NEDO (Japan’s New Energy and Industrial Technology Development Organization) and SEDA chose it: proving that deep energy retrofits work on ordinary, aging stock – not just new-build showcases – is the whole point of the exercise. The project marks a first for the Malaysian market, where ZEB conversions of existing commercial buildings have yet to be attempted at this scale.

Glass as infrastructure, not just enclosure

AGC’s contribution leans on two product lines that treat the building envelope as an active energy system rather than a passive barrier. Its Stopray Vision 40T, a high-performance Low-E coated glass, is engineered to let daylight flood in while keeping solar heat and thermal transfer in check — addressing the classic retrofit tension between comfort and consumption without resorting to heavy tinting or an overhauled facade aesthetic.

Sitting alongside it are AGC’s SunEwat Vision and SunEwat SUDARE ranges — building-integrated photovoltaic (BIPV) glazing that turns window surfaces themselves into power generators. For retrofit projects especially, where roof space or land for conventional solar arrays is often limited, generating electricity through the vertical envelope offers a workaround that doesn’t disrupt the building’s appearance or footprint.

A regional decarbonization play

For AGC, the SEDA project reads as much as a proof-of-concept for ASEAN expansion as a one-off engagement. The company has framed its involvement around tailoring energy-saving and power-generating glass technologies to local climate and building-use conditions – language that signals an eye toward replicating the model across other tropical, humidity-heavy markets in the region where cooling loads dominate energy bills.

The initiative sits within a broader NEDO-led push to export Japanese energy-efficiency know-how into Southeast Asia, with SEDA Malaysia serving as the on-the-ground counterpart. Full technical details of the collaboration are available via NEDO’s official release.

AGC Inc., parent of the AGC Group, ranks among the world’s largest glass solutions providers, with roughly 56,000 employees and annual sales near ¥1.7 trillion across some 30 countries.
